Criminal Justice Department

Refresher Academy

Criminal Justice Home | Academy | Criminal Justice Program | Refresher Academy | Faculty | FAQs

The Arapahoe Community College Law Enforcement Refresher Academy consists of two components.

  • Online academic refresher
  • Skills training

Online Academic Refresher: The focus of this portion of the academy is Colorado criminal and motor vehicle code, Colorado and U.S. Constitutional law, and ethics as it relates to the Peace Officer Standards and Training (P.O.S.T.). This course prepares students to identify their weak areas of knowledge and directs students learning to specifically improve those areas. The online law refresher is hosted by Knowledge Factor, Inc. Skills training: The focus of this portion of the academy is the three primary skills required by P.O.S.T.: arrest control, driving and firearms. All three skills may be taken through Arapahoe Community College’s Law Enforcement Academy.

Each component of the Refresher Academy is separate; a student can sign up for one component (either the academic refresher, all skills or certain skills) or all components. If you are confident in your skills ability, then you are welcome to sign up for only the online law refresher. Individuals who are confident in their skills ability, will need to schedule and to participate in a two-day test-out through P.O.S.T. The two-day test-out allows these individuals to take the written P.O.S.T. exam and practical exams pertaining to arrest control, firearms and driving over a two-day period. Certification

Upon completion of the online academic refresher course, and proof of training and competency in arrest control, driving and firearms, Arapahoe Community College’s Law Enforcement Academy will issue a certificate for the completed online academic refresher and skills. While the online law refresher is self-paced, it must be completed within four months from enrollment.
